We are a growing fintech looking to add an experienced Compliance Business Analyst to our Client Operations team in Chennai, India!
As a Compliance Business Analyst, you'll be responsible for ensuring adherence to relevant laws and regulations, identifying potential risks, and implementing effective compliance programs, while also analysing data and providing recommendations for improvement.
The Compliance Business Analyst plays a crucial role in ensuring the organization's compliance with relevant laws, regulations, and internal policies. This position involves analysing data, identifying potential risks, developing and implementing compliance programs, and providing recommendations for improvement.
What you’ll be responsible for in this role:
- Compliance Monitoring and Assessment:
- Monitor organizational activities and processes to ensure compliance with relevant laws, regulations, and internal policies.
- Identify potential compliance risks and issues.
- Conduct compliance reviews and audits.
- Data Analysis and Reporting:
- Analyze data to identify trends, patterns, and potential compliance issues.
- Prepare reports and presentations summarizing compliance findings and recommendations.
- Track and monitor compliance metrics.
- Compliance Program Development and Implementation:
- Assist in the development and implementation of compliance programs and procedures.
- Develop and deliver compliance training programs.
- Stay informed about changes in laws, regulations, and industry best practices.
- Communication and Collaboration:
- Communicate compliance requirements and expectations to relevant stakeholders.
- Collaborate with other departments to address compliance issues.
- Maintain strong working relationships with regulatory agencies and external auditors.
- Other Duties:
- Perform other duties as assigned by the Compliance Manager/Officer.
What experiences and skills are necessary to be successful in this role:
- Bachelor's/Master’s degree in a relevant field (e.g., Business Administration) or equivalent experience.
- 2-3 years of experience in compliance, risk management, or a related field.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
- Proficiency in data analysis and reporting tools.
- Knowledge of relevant laws, regulations, and industry best practices.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Attention to detail and a commitment to accuracy.
- Certifications: Relevant compliance certifications (e.g., Certified Compliance Professional) are a plus.
